Abstract
The acquisition of the skill of reading comprehension plays an important role in the students’ obtaining a lot of other information. The findings of research carried out reveals that students at different class levels can be taught various reading comprehension skills through direct instruction. In this study, the focus is on how direct instruction can be applied in the teaching of reading comprehension skills, and the stages of application of the direct instruction method in single action story reading comprehension designed for story grammar, are explained.
